Abstract
The utility model provides a full -automatic puttying device, include: defeated material mechanism, it is including the motor, transmission shaft and the screw rod external member that connect gradually, the screw rod external member sets up in the feed bin, the feed bin sets up in the storage bucket, and be provided with feed inlet and discharge gate on the feed bin, spouting and scraping the mechanism, it includes the sweep -out mechanism conveying pipeline of being connected with the discharge gate, the sweep -out mechanism conveying pipeline is connected with sweep -out mechanism conveying mouth through gun type accuse material switch, spout and scrape the mechanism and still include wing and shell to and scrape the extra long telescopic link that high operation was used. The utility model is simple and reasonable in structure, portable, the ejection of compact is stable, and is efficient, through per hour 400 square metres accessible actual measurements.

Specific embodiment
This utility model is described in further detail below in conjunction with the accompanying drawings, to make those skilled in the art with reference to explanation
Book word can be implemented according to this.
Embodiment one
As shown in figure 1, this utility model provides a kind of full-automatic Puttying device, including feeding unit and spraying and scraping machine
Structure.
Wherein, the feeding unit includes motor 1, power transmission shaft 2, bung fixed mount 3, body fixed screw 4, bearing external member
5th, discharging opening 6, feed bin 7, screw set 8 and charging aperture 9.Feeding unit is perpendicularly inserted in charging basket.Motor 1 passes through power transmission shaft 2
It is connected with screw set 8, is rotated with drive screw external member 8.Feeding unit can be fixed on by charging basket by bung fixed mount 3
At bung, prevent the vibration that motor 1 is produced when rotating from topple over feeding unit.Screw set 8 is arranged in feed bin 7, charging aperture 9
The top of feed bin 7 is arranged on, discharging opening 6 is arranged on the bottom of feed bin 7, and charging aperture 9 is connected with charging basket, when motor 1 is by passing
When moving axis 2 drives screw set 8 to rotate, using the principle of spiral conveying, the generation negative pressure of feed bin 7 is made, make the material Jing in charging basket
Cross charging aperture 9 to enter in feed bin 7, then discharging opening 6 is pushed to through screw set 8, be conveyed to spraying and scraping machine structure.
The spraying and scraping machine structure includes outer housing 10, ten thousand font wings 11, wing fixed screw 12, scraper motor 13, scrapes
Machine discharging opening 14, gun-type material controlling switch 15, pikestaff 16, sweep-out mechanism conveying pipeline 17, automatic material controlling feeding back device 18, switch coupling assembly
19.The ten thousand fonts wing 11 can also scrape flat brush using " ten thousand " font.
Wherein, discharging opening 6 is connected with automatic material controlling feeding back device 18, makes the material flowed out from discharging opening 6 through control automatically
Material feeding back device 18 is transported to gun-type material controlling switch 15 and is sent to sweep-out mechanism discharging opening 14, and now scraper motor 13 is rotated, and is driven
Ten thousand font wings 11 do circular-rotation, and the material exported from sweep-out mechanism discharging opening 14 is uniformly scraped into metope, realize in spray
The pattern scraped.Automatically material controlling feeding back device 18 can again be transmitted back to unnecessary material in charging basket.
Embodiment two
As shown in Fig. 2 the technical scheme in the present embodiment is with the difference of embodiment one, charging aperture 9 is arranged on feed bin 7
Bottom, discharging opening 6 is arranged on the top of feed bin 7, and motor 1 drives screw set 8 to rotate backward by power transmission shaft 2, using spiral shell
The principle of rotation conveying, makes the generation negative pressure of feed bin 7, and the material for making charging basket bottom is entered in feed bin 7 through charging aperture 9, then Jing
Cross screw set 8 and be pushed to discharging opening 6, be conveyed to spraying and scraping machine structure, the spray for carrying out putty is scraped.
